Taking over from me means owning the bounce processor end to end. Key things: the classifier distinguishes hard and soft bounces; soft bounces retry three times before suppression. The suppression list syncs hourly — if it stalls, restart the sync worker, not the whole service. Dead-letter queue needs manual review weekly; nobody automated that yet. Deploys go through the standard pipeline, nothing exotic. Alerts page the on-call rotation. The production configuration you'll be working against is reproduced below.

deployment values, kajep-kageg:
[praix]
host = praix.paliqcorp.corp
user = praix_svc
database = praix_prod

LAUNCH BRIEFING — VELTRIX HOMEHUB

Board review, Q3 cycle. Launch set for the Arlenport market first, national rollout eight weeks later. Manufacturing at the Dunmere plant is on schedule; channel agreements signed with two regional distributors. Marketing spend front-loaded into the first month. Pricing holds at the tier agreed in June. Risks: component lead times, competitor response from Orvane Systems. Mitigations documented in the appendix. The confidential note below outlines our position beyond the rollout.

board note of kageg-bahof: The renewal with Holwynax Holdings closes at $2 million a year, 5 percent below the last contract. Project Ulaath slips by two quarters because of the supplier delay.

**Mgmt Meeting Minutes — Retiring the Brightline Range**

Quick recap for sales leads at Fenholt Supplies: we agreed to retire the Brightline fixture range by year-end. Remaining stock moves to clearance pricing next month, and accounts on standing orders get migrated to the Lumetta range. Trade-in incentives were approved in principle. The confidential note on next steps sits just below.

board note of bajof-bajeg: The pricing group signed off on a budget of $13.4 million for Project Sildor. The renewal with Lamixek Holdings closes at $48.9 million a year, 49 percent above the last contract.

Subject: FD leak cut-over done

Team,

Cut-over to the patched Harborline gateway finished at 03:40. The descriptor leak traced to the retry pool not closing sockets on timeout. Old nodes drained, new build holding steady under load. Watch fd counts for 24h; page Priya's rotation if they climb. Active config on the new fleet follows.

deployment values, bahop-yadug:
[caswyn]
port = 8443
region = east-4
host = caswyn.lumicworks.internal
timeout_ms = 5000
retries = 8